Output d12e7743510a2efce295005a1881dce47b76f5268a08bb0356af0e3dbd75a803:2

value
166148241
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d84bee149a337d5d954dc7543bd73c61c80de540 OP_EQUAL
address
3MQgqgsAisKUyqoynJ7thmxF8dzEQJejVF
transaction
d12e7743510a2efce295005a1881dce47b76f5268a08bb0356af0e3dbd75a803
spent
true